.elementor-1046 .elementor-element.elementor-element-34f8cf3 > .elementor-container > .elementor-column > .elementor-widget-wrap{align-content:center;align-items:center;}.elementor-widget-media-carousel .elementor-carousel-image-overlay{font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-1046 .elementor-element.elementor-element-dce5add.elementor-skin-slideshow .elementor-main-swiper:not(.elementor-thumbnails-swiper){margin-bottom:0px;}.elementor-1046 .elementor-element.elementor-element-dce5add .elementor-main-swiper{height:100vh;}.elementor-1046 .elementor-element.elementor-element-dce5add .elementor-swiper-button{font-size:20px;}@media(max-width:1024px){.elementor-1046 .elementor-element.elementor-element-dce5add.elementor-skin-slideshow .elementor-main-swiper:not(.elementor-thumbnails-swiper){margin-bottom:0px;}.elementor-1046 .elementor-element.elementor-element-dce5add .elementor-main-swiper{height:100vh;}}@media(max-width:767px){.elementor-1046 .elementor-element.elementor-element-dce5add.elementor-skin-slideshow .elementor-main-swiper:not(.elementor-thumbnails-swiper){margin-bottom:0px;}}/* Start custom CSS for section, class: .elementor-element-34f8cf3 */html, body {
  margin: 0;
  padding: 0;
  height: 100%;
  overflow: hidden; /* Kizárja a görgetést */
}

.swiper {
  width: 100vw; /* Kitölti a képernyő teljes szélességét */
  height: 100vw; /* Kitölti a képernyő teljes magasságát */
}

.swiper-slide-inner {
  top: 0px;
  width: auto;
  height: auto; /* Középre igazítja a képet */
}

.swiper-slide-image {
  width: 100%; /* A szélesség a konténerhez igazodik */
  height: auto; /* Magasság arányosan változik */
}/* End custom CSS */